A historic movie which is loosely based on the book of the same name from Valerio Massimo Manfredi. Also very loosely based on real historical events and more a fantasized history approach. The movie starts when the twelve year old RomulusA historic movie which is loosely based on the book of the same name from Valerio Massimo Manfredi. Also very loosely based on real historical events and more a fantasized history approach. The movie starts when the twelve year old Romulus Augustus is crowned to become emperor of the (western) Roman empire (This was not uncommon in history and there were even far younger emperors. Those were mostly just puppets or in name emperors for the real rulers). At this time the western Roman empire is just a shadow from what it was before and dependent of foreign military leaders and their soldiers (Was also true in real live). Odoaker a powerful leader of the Goths who helped Romulus father takes over Rom as he feels betrayed. Romulus is put in exile when a group of loyal legionnaires tries to rescue him. Their only hope to restore him as emperor is a lost legion which vanished in Britain as all other option are already out of the pictures and even the eastern Roman empire does not help them. Short interruption for a real life history lesson: The Roman empire was in his later history split between an eastern and western empire. The eastern empire also called Byzantine empire continued to exist for around 1000 more years from this time even when there are debates by historians if eastern Romans were truly Romans (This is not a joke). For the western Roman empire this age is for some historians the beginning of the end of western Rom which is also debatable as many following rulers will still call themselves Roman emperors or rulers and would be recognized in their time as such. Back to the review. With this in mind they make the long journey to try to find the lost legion in Britain. This is the introduction of the movie. I like the story and characters. It is an interesting Hollywood approach or fantasy history that has everything to be entertaining. At the end it has a nice twist that you might see coming or know when you read the description even the one on Metacritic. Most complains are about the story and I disagree. This is an entertainment movie and does not claim to be historic or historical correct. It is also not aimed to be intellectual so the critic is not valid for me in this case. If you want something more accurate and still entertaining watch the excellent Rom series (HBO?) or documentaries. For the cast we got a good value of great actors with Colin Firth as Aurelius, legendary Ben Kingsley as Ambrosius (best actor in the movie), Aishwarya Rai as Mira (hidden gem of the movie), Harry Van Gorkum as Vortgyn and Thomas Brodie Sangster as Romulus Augustus to name a few. A really well done performance for this kind of movie and I cared for the characters. The sets, costumes and weapons look good and convincing (Even if I am sure that these are not historical accurate). The battles and fights are well done and entertaining so I have no complains here to. There is some good humor here and there and even after years I remember a few funny scenes. Overall this is an entertaining and enjoyable movie. Not a masterpiece but definitely worth watching and rememberable. I bought also the book after seeing the movie but have yet to read it. Expand
